AI Technical Summary
Existing rocker arm assemblies for internal combustion engines, particularly in heavy-duty applications, lack a cost-effective and structurally simple mechanism for variable valve lift control, leading to inefficiencies and increased wear.
A rocker arm arrangement featuring a laterally projecting drive element connected to a hydraulically adjustable actuating element with an integrated check valve, allowing for variable valve lift control through hydraulic actuation, minimizing wear and reducing component tolerance requirements.
Enables efficient variable valve lift control with reduced wear, lower production costs, and simplified assembly, while minimizing hydraulic fluid compression volume for rapid switching times.
